Dust settles on shelving units, debris accumulates in corners, and oil stains mark the pathways where forklifts travel. These details of a warehouse might seem minor compared to meeting shipment deadlines or managing inventory levels, but you cannot overlook them.
From the safety of your team members to the accuracy of your inventory systems, maintaining clean conditions creates a foundation for success that extends well beyond appearances.
Ensures Safety for Warehouse Workers
Your employees face risks every day as they navigate heavy machinery, lift packages, and move through tight spaces between storage areas. Clean floors prevent slip-and-fall incidents that can result in serious injuries and costly workers’ compensation claims.
Proper maintenance removes oil spills, water accumulation, and loose debris that create dangerous walking surfaces. When you maintain clear pathways and spotless work areas, your team can focus on their tasks without worrying about hidden hazards.
Regular cleaning protocols ensure that emergency exits remain accessible and visible. Fire safety equipment stays functional when dust and grime don’t accumulate on sprinkler systems or block access to extinguishers. Your safety record improves dramatically when you prioritize cleanliness as a fundamental safety measure.

Increases the Accuracy of Inventory Management

Easy access to all parts of the warehouse simplifies inventory management and improves accuracy. Clean, clutter-free storage areas reduce the risk of misplaced or incorrectly stored items, ensuring everything stays in its designated place.
A clean environment also supports the reliability of your inventory tracking technology. Barcode scanners and other tools perform better without dust buildup, which can cause scanning errors or malfunctions that lead to inventory discrepancies. By maintaining regular cleaning routines, you can prevent these issues and streamline your processes.
With improved organization and reliable equipment, your inventory accuracy rates will rise, helping you avoid stockouts, overordering, and customer dissatisfaction.
Reduces the Likelihood of Pest Infestations
Pests gravitate toward warehouses that offer food sources, water, and hiding places among accumulated debris or poorly maintained areas. Your facility becomes less attractive to rodents, insects, and other unwanted visitors when you eliminate their ideal living conditions.
Regular cleaning plays a key role in this process. Remove all crumbs, spills, and organic matter that can attract pests. Addressing issues like standing water from leaks or poor drainage is equally important, as these areas can become breeding grounds for insects. Cluttered spaces also create ideal nesting sites for rodents, making consistent maintenance essential for keeping pests at bay.
A clean facility doesn’t just deter pests; it also makes professional pest control treatments more effective. When surfaces are free of dust and debris, treatments can reach their target areas more efficiently, ensuring better results and reducing the likelihood of infestations. By staying proactive, you create an environment that’s less hospitable to pests and easier to protect.
Protects Products From Damage
Pests aren’t the only threat to your products. Dust and debris can easily accumulate in storage areas, potentially damaging sensitive electronics, contaminating food items, or degrading materials like textiles and packaging. Moisture buildup, often overlooked, can also lead to mold or corrosion, further compromising the quality of your inventory.
Maintaining a clean warehouse environment is essential for protecting your products and your bottom line. Regular cleaning prevents dust and dirt from settling on goods, helping to preserve their quality and extend their shelf life. A well-maintained space also reduces the risk of contamination, ensuring compliance with health and safety standards.
Maintains the Functionality of Your Warehouse Equipment
In a warehouse, it’s not just the products at risk from poor maintenance; it’s also the equipment that keeps everything moving. Conveyor belts, sorting systems, and automated machinery can’t function effectively in dusty, debris-filled environments. Accumulated grime can jam moving parts, while dust buildup interferes with sensors and electronic components, causing costly disruptions.
Maintaining a clean facility directly impacts equipment reliability and lifespan. Ventilation systems, for example, perform better and use less energy when they aren’t overloaded with airborne particles. Cleaner air circulation also ensures better temperature and humidity control, creating optimal conditions for both products and machinery.
By prioritizing consistent cleanliness, you’ll reduce maintenance costs, extend equipment lifespans, and maintain peak performance across all your warehouse systems.
